How much is the original price of the 2021 Mercedes c300?

The 2021 Mercedes-Benz C-Class Sedan price starts at $41,600 MSRP. Why are Mercedes so expensive in America?

The better the parts, the better the car, after all. Mercedes has a long history of using cutting edge technology in their vehicles. While that means great, innovative features for each new model, it also means a lot of time in research and development, which can cost quite a bit of money.
